Lattice Diamond Design Software Named Finalist In Elektra Awards Competition

Lattice Semiconductor Corporation today announced that an independent panel of judges has named the Lattice Diamond design software environment a finalist in Elektra 2010, the European Electronics Industry Awards competition.

“This highly sought-after recognition from the Elektra 2010 judges is very exciting,” said Doug Hunter, Lattice Vice President of Corporate Marketing. “Lattice Diamond software is the new flagship design environment for Lattice FPGA products. Lattice Diamond software provides a complete set of powerful tools, efficient design flows and modern user interface that enables designers to more quickly target low power, cost sensitive FPGA applications.”

Now in its eighth year and firmly established as an annual high point of the electronics industry, the Elektra Awards give the industry the opportunity to recognize the achievements of individuals and companies. The Awards ceremony is scheduled for December 9 at The Lancaster London Hotel.
